Side by side

Shopify vs. custom eCommerce, which is better?

Factor Shopify Custom eCommerce
Setup speed Fast, launch in days with a theme; no developer required for basics 4 to 8 weeks from scope sign-off; built from scratch around your brand and catalog
Monthly cost CA$39, CA$399+/mo platform fee, plus app subscriptions; ongoing forever One-time build from CA$3,950; no platform fee, hosting only (typically CA$20 to 40/mo)
Customization High within themes; deep customization requires Liquid dev work and can hit platform limits Unlimited, built precisely to your design, workflows, and integrations with no platform constraints
Ownership You rent the platform; if Shopify changes pricing or policies, you're affected You own 100% of the code and content at handoff, no lock-in, ever
Best for Businesses that want a fast start with minimal technical complexity and are comfortable with monthly fees Businesses that want brand-precise design, no recurring platform fees, or complex integrations

Must-have features

What features should a small-business online store have?

Every eCommerce site we build is measured against this list, not checked off, but built in from the start.

  • Product pages with variants & multiple images, each product shows size/colour/style options and real photography or mockups
  • Mobile-first design, over 60% of Canadian shoppers buy on a phone; the store must work perfectly at every screen size
  • Secure, frictionless cart & checkout, minimal steps, guest checkout option, and trust signals (SSL badge, secure icon) at payment
  • Canadian payment methods, Interac, Visa/Mastercard/Amex, and digital wallets (Apple Pay, Google Pay)
  • Shipping & Canadian tax calculation, real-time carrier quotes and province-level HST/GST/PST so no manual math at checkout
  • Inventory management admin, a simple backend for stock counts, price updates, and new product adds without a developer
  • Abandoned-cart recovery, automated email to shoppers who left without buying; one of the highest-ROI store features available
  • Analytics & conversion tracking, revenue, sessions, conversion rate, and average order value visible at a glance
  • Core Web Vitals speed budget, LCP <2.5s ensures the store is fast enough to rank on Google and fast enough to keep shoppers
  • SEO-ready product & category pages, unique titles, meta descriptions, and structured data (Product schema) on every product

Shopify vs custom eCommerce, which is better?
Shopify launches faster and is easier to manage without technical help. A custom store costs more upfront but has no monthly platform fees, can be built exactly to your brand, and you own the code outright. Most small Canadian businesses with straightforward catalogs do well on Shopify; custom is better when you need tight brand control, complex integrations, or want to eliminate recurring fees.

Which payment options work best for Canadian eCommerce?
Interac, Visa, Mastercard, Amex, and digital wallets (Apple Pay, Google Pay) cover the Canadian market. We integrate whichever processor fits your business, Stripe, Square, or your bank's gateway, and ensure Interac Online is supported where applicable.
